后方格智能化观察网
首页 > 机器人 > 机器视觉培训如何赋能算法以超越人类的图像理解能力

机器视觉培训如何赋能算法以超越人类的图像理解能力

机器视觉培训:如何赋能算法以超越人类的图像理解能力?

机器视觉培训之需

在现代技术发展中,机器视觉已经成为人工智能领域中的重要组成部分。它能够让计算机通过摄像头或其他传感器捕捉和分析环境信息,从而实现自动化识别、分类和处理图像任务。然而,为了使这些系统能够在复杂的场景中准确工作,需要进行深入的训练。

训练数据的准备与选择

有效的训练数据是高质量机器视觉培训不可或缺的一环。合适的数据集可以帮助模型学习特征并提高泛化能力。在实际应用中,这通常涉及到收集标注好的示例图片,以便模型学习区分不同类别,并学会如何对新未见过的情况做出预测。

模型架构与优化

当我们拥有了足够数量且质量良好的训练数据后,就可以开始探索不同的模型架构来找到最适合当前问题所需解决的问题。这包括卷积神经网络(CNN)等常用的深度学习结构,它们被广泛用于各种图像识别任务。此外,对于性能有提升需求,还需要不断尝试不同的优化策略,如调整超参数、使用批量归一化、残差连接以及正则化技术等。

训练过程中的挑战

在进行机器视觉培训时,我们可能会遇到一些挑战,比如样本不均衡的问题。当某个类别中的样本远多于其他类时,不同类型之间难以平衡,这将影响整个系统的性能。在这种情况下,可以采用重采样方法或者增加背景噪声来改善这一点。

跨域问题与迁移学习

实际应用场景往往存在跨域现象,即训练和测试阶段所处环境相互独立,导致模型无法很好地适应新的环境。这时候,可借助迁移学习,将预先在一个领域获得的大量知识转移到另一个相关但不同领域。通过共享前层网络权重,然后在特定任务上微调,可以大幅缩短训练时间并提高结果精度。

监督与无监督方法比较

另一个关键决策是选择是否使用监督式还是无监督式训练。在监督式设置下,算法直接从标记数据中学习,而无监督方式则要求它们自己发现模式和关系。如果目标是明确确定物体种类,那么监督式方法更为合适;如果希望自动发现图像间潜在联系,无监督则是一个更好的选择。

硬件加速与云服务平台

随着深度学习技术日益普及,大规模计算资源变得尤为重要。不论是在研究还是生产级应用中,都会依赖强大的硬件支持,比如GPU(专用显卡)、TPU(谷歌推出的专用芯片)等,以及提供高效分布式计算服务的云平台,如AWS、Google Cloud Platform或Azure。这些工具允许我们快速部署大量并行计算,同时降低成本,使得以前无法实现的大规模实验现在变得可行。

持续评估与反馈循环

最后的步骤是对经过完善的人工智能系统进行持续评估,并根据反馈进一步调整其性能。一旦该系统投入实际操作,它将不断接收新的输入,并根据这些输入产生输出,从而获取关于自己的行为反馈利用这些建立起来的人工智能框架,在实践中持续改进其表现,最终达到最佳状态。这是一个动态循环过程,每一步都离不开对原有理论基础以及最新研究成果保持关注更新换代的心态去跟随时代发展前进。

标签:

猜你喜欢

强力推荐